1. Wood Waste Processing Line Introduction

Wood waste is a cheap, recyclable raw material including tree branches, logs, pallets, bark, wood chips, sawmill scraps and agricultural straw. To turn bulky, uneven wood waste into standard biomass fuel pellets, a full set of processing equipment is required. Among all core machines, the wood hammer mill undertakes the critical crushing stage, which directly decides pellet quality, production efficiency and die service life.
A complete wood waste processing line centered on hammer mill covers feeding, crushing, drying, pelletizing, cooling and packaging. This article explains the whole layout, equipment functions, capacity matching standards and business advantages for biomass investors.

2. Full Workflow of Wood Waste Pellet Line with Hammer Mill

  1. Raw Material FeedingChain plate feeder transports large wood scraps, logs and pallets uniformly to primary shredder. Blockage and overload protection ensure stable continuous feeding.
  2. Primary Coarse ShreddingBig wood blocks are cut into 2–5cm wood chips via wood shredder, lowering feeding pressure for the follow-up hammer mill.
  3. Fine Crushing by Wood Hammer Mill (Core Section)Pre-shredded wood chips enter industrial hammer mill. High-speed alloy hammers strike materials to produce uniform sawdust of 3–10 mm. Replaceable screen mesh adjusts finished particle size to match pellet mill requirements.Built-in dust removal system controls flying sawdust; wear-resistant hammer pieces extend service life for long-shift operation.
  4. Sawdust DryingWet sawdust from hammer mill usually contains 30–50% moisture. Rotary dryer reduces moisture to 12–18%, the ideal range for pellet molding.
  5. Pellet MoldingQualified dry sawdust is sent to ring die pellet mill, extruded into solid cylindrical fuel pellets under high temperature and pressure.
  6. Cooling & ScreeningHot soft pellets pass through counter-flow cooler to reduce temperature and hardness. Screener removes powder and unqualified broken pellets for reprocessing via hammer mill.
  7. Finished Product Storage & PackingQualified wood pellets are stored in silos, then automatically packed into ton bags or small retail bags for delivery.

3. Core Function of Hammer Mill in Pellet Manufacturing Line

  1. Standardize Raw Material Particle SizePellet machines cannot process oversized wood chunks. The hammer mill breaks materials into consistent fine sawdust to guarantee smooth extrusion and high pellet forming rate.
  2. Improve Drying EfficiencyFine sawdust has larger contact area with hot air in dryers, cutting drying time and lowering fuel consumption of the whole line.
  3. Reduce Wear Loss of Pellet Mill DieUniform small particles avoid uneven friction inside the ring die, greatly extending die service life and lowering spare part replacement costs.
  4. Flexible Compatibility of Raw MaterialsOne industrial wood hammer mill handles mixed wood waste: pallets, branches, bark, waste furniture and wood offcuts. Factories can collect multiple waste materials to cut raw material costs.

4. Matching Hammer Mill Capacity for Different Pellet Lines

  • Small pellet plant (0.5–1t/h finished pellets): 2–5t/h wood hammer mill
  • Medium biomass factory (2–5t/h pellets): 8–15t/h heavy-duty hammer mill
  • Large industrial pellet line (8–15t/h pellets): Double rotor large output hammer mill with double feeding ports
Support customized hammer mill screen size according to local raw material characteristics.

5. Supporting Auxiliary Equipment Matching Hammer Mill

  • Magnetic separator: Remove iron nails, screws from waste pallets before hammer mill to protect hammers and screen from damage
  • Pulse dust collector: Collect sawdust dust generated during hammer milling, meet EU environmental emission standards
  • Conveyor belts & screw conveyors: Automatic closed material transportation to save labor cost
  • Cyclone separator: Separate light impurities mixed in sawdust after hammer mill

7. Wood Waste Processing Line Common FAQ

  1. Can one hammer mill process both dry and wet wood waste?Standard hammer mills fit materials below 25% moisture. Super wet wood needs pre-drying before crushing.
  2. How often to replace hammer mill wear parts?Alloy hammers work 800–1200 working hours under normal wood waste processing conditions.
